I managed to actually finish a Rubik’s cube for the first time yesterday. I would have to say however, that is was mainly a fluke.

It comes with instructions that are actually fairly easy to follow… but I must admit that I don’t do most of the first steps because it’s easier just to do it my own way. However, the sequences of moves to get the last few steps are quite useful as they show you how to manipulate small parts of the cube at a time without disturbing the rest of the pieces. The process is supposed to only take 7 steps. Not bad really. I can get to the seventh step in a matter of minuets without any problem. However, the 7th step has you doing the same sequence of moves either 2, 4, or 8 times. Each time I would do that sequence it would just mess it up more and more. It never made any sense. Movie Review: Legend

This little known movie (at least in the circles I swim in) just happens to be one of my favorite movies. Legend features a very young Tom Cruise and Alice Playten. Also, I never would have guessed it but the antagonist is played by none other than Tim Curry! It’s hard to imagine the guy who played Dr. Frankfurter also plays one of the coolest bad guys as the Lord of Darkness… but there he is.

In any case, it’s a very old movie (1985, the year I was born), but it is awesome. It captured my imagination as a child and has held it every since. I would even go as far as to credit this movie with my interest in the fantasy world. It’s all just so romantic and cool. The costumes are awesome, the special effects are great for their time and the story line is both unique and interesting.. though I can tell that there is a TON of backstory that we’re just not getting.

If you’re into fantasy at all. Get this movie! I promise, you won’t be let down. We just recently got it on DVD. I didn’t even think it would ever come out on DVD. Before this, the only place I had ever seen it was on TV late at night. It’s a very under appreciated movie.
